Here’s 10 things to do with a pepper:
(for some of these I could easily use two peppers – use lots as they are highly nutritious and very low calorie!):
- Eaten as they are, as you would eat an apple (my 2 year old Conor does this in his buggy, we get some odd looks!)
- Sliced up and dunked in to humus or salsa
- Use large chunks to scoop up cottage cheese as a low fat, high protein snack
- Diced and added to bolognaise or chilli
- Strips in stir fry
- Roasted in the oven at 180c for about 20minutes
- Diced in an omlette
- Diced in mini pastry-less quiches: beat 3 eggs, add pepper, grated cheese and tuna/ham. Pour in to silicone muffin cases, bake in oven for about 10-15 minutes at 180c.
- Stuffed with other ingredients.
- Smoothie – red pepper in a smoothie??!! I haven’t tried this one yet, but it looks interesting!
